    I use All Posters and have excellent pictures, I recently did a normal image taken on holiday and made into a 46 x 61 cm picture and was more than impressed at the result. Brilliant clear crisp image and no distortion.
    My daughter thinks picture is lovely (taken art Machu Picchu a few years ago) and so I have had another done for them (her & Hubby) for Christmas.

    They might not be as cheap as some other places but it really depends on the quality you want. The size you want is around £45 (today they have 25% off but they often have offers and as one ends another starts. You should get delivery in plenty of time for Christmas) http://www.allposters.co.uk/
